[EXCLUSIVE] Local Eatery Shutters Intown Restaurant After Mere Months in Business

The Local Tavern closed Sunday night August 30th after a little more than nine months in business.  The upscale eatery and bar opened at 2149 Briarcliff Road on November 17, 2025.  No reason was provided for the closure, but a Duluth location - Local on North - controlled by the same owner, Kamal Preet (aka Kamal Singh), remains open. 

When the Briarcliff location opened within its 3,200 square foot space in Briar Vista shopping center, it replaced what had most recently been Red Pepper Taqueria, and before that, Artuzzi's, a failed quick-serve Italian chain.  

Preet purchased The Local on North in Duluth in August 2020 from its original owners Georganne Rose and Salem Makhloaf.  (A Canton location by the same name was not part of the 2020 sale.)  Preet reportedly also owns other franchised and independent restaurants, both in metro Atlanta and out of state, but The Local Tavern was seemingly his first attempt at growing a business he had acquired into other areas.  

Opening in a predominantly orthodox Jewish area with a menu that featured shrimp, pork, and mussels likely did not resonate with the locals, and its upscale bar model likely similarly did not resonate with Emory students and families.  

That said, it's worth noting the restaurant did boast a solid 4.8/5 star rating on Google with nearly 200 reviews.  The Duluth location, which opened in early 2019, has an over 4.5 star rating with nearly 800 reviews.   

The intersection of Briarcliff and LaVista Roads has also been plagued by seemingly never ending road work for years, and that nuisance has no doubt had an impact on would-be diners' willingness to frequent the center.  A freestanding Starbucks in the front of the center - literally at the hard corner of LaVista and Briarcliff - previously closed temporarily [because of the road work] but never reopened and remains vacant.
